Really Big Sky offers a visually striking and fast-paced shoot 'em up experience, blending vibrant visuals with intense arcade action. With its procedurally generated levels and dynamic gameplay, it provides endless replayability and excitement. The game's variety of power-ups and upgrades allow for customization and strategic depth, enhancing the player's experience. Despite its challenging difficulty and lack of narrative depth, its addictive gameplay and stunning visuals keep players engaged. Really Big Sky stands as a standout title in the shoot 'em up genre, offering a thrilling and visually captivating experience for players.

Game is hard to enjoy. Too many lights and events where not only is really hard to see, you don't even know what is happening. Game has zero learning curve where you start slow and easy and it gets gradually more challenging. After a short tutorial, you are thrown to the lions where it is hard as hell to learn the game when you don't know what's going on or how to face things and you are lucky if you survive more than 1 minute straight. Gave it a try because it had potential but gets frustrating and boring too fast.
Really Big Sky is certainly not the world's best (arcade) SHMUP but it can be fun! The game drastically overuses particle and light effects. However, this is part of the fun and makes you go "Whoa, what's going on here" time and again. The number of enemies and bosses is limited, it still takes some time to master them. I think I had seen all after 5 hours but kept playing to grind more achievements and to have some fun. Technically, you cannot beat this game, you can only get a better high score. However, there are plenty of game modes and unlocks (it almost feels like a roguelite in that sense). This is one of those games you would keep on your old laptop in case you need a game fix while you travel. 6.5/10
